Return Fire Tube Patents (Class 122/410)
  • Patent number: 11953231
    Abstract: A heating device includes a housing closed with a cover element and enclosing a combustion chamber, wherein an opening for receiving a burner device pointing into the combustion chamber is provided on the cover element, wherein the opening is delimited by a first cylindrical sheet section of the cover element (1), wherein the first sheet section is connected to a second sheet section of the cover element so as to face away from the combustion chamber. The second sheet section extends radially outwards as a contact flange for the burner device.

  • Patent number: 10502368
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a heater suitable for heating a flow of natural gas. There is provided a heater (1) suitable for heating a flow of natural gas, comprising a vessel (2) containing a heat transfer fluid, a heat source tube (3) passing through the vessel and being at least partially immersed in the heat transfer fluid, the heat source tube (3) being suppliable with heated gas to allow the heated gas to flow along the heat source tube (3) to evaporate the heat transfer fluid and at least one heat exchanger being connectable to a source of second fluid (9) to be heated, the heat exchanger being arranged so that the second fluid can be heated by the evaporated heat transfer fluid.
